Now that we’ve seen the basis for Dragonknight, I just wanted to provide some feedback on the artistic style of the class.

While I understand Class Identity was a major factor for this rework, I believe it is incredibly important to understand that each Skill Line is its own individual concept.

In a world with Subclassing, I want to reiterate, that we should avoid Skill Lines like Earthen Heart and Ardent Flame looking Draconic… that is what we have Draconic Power for. When I look at a skill like Earthspike Mantle and see dragon spikes, or Searing Strike and see a dragon’s claw, they feel like Draconic Power abilities.

When I go to Subclass one of these skill lines to make my own unique Class, I’m doing so for the theme of the line, not because I want to be part Dragonknight.

My hope is that this is considered for future reworks knowing that Class Identity is important, it is equally important to appreciate and value our new player made Classes too.
